Advertise a mix of areas and property types

Advertising is one of the most effective ways to attract potential leads. And it’s not a one size fits all approach. Where, when, and how much to advertise depends on your specific goals and leveraging an omnichannel approach, which integrates ads in search engines, on popular websites, and on social media gives you the flexibility to reach your ideal customers in the most effective way. For real estate investors specifically, knowing who you want to reach and what their motivations are is key – are investors looking to flip properties, keep them as a source of passive income, manage several properties, or something else altogether?

With online advertising for real estate investors, you can tailor your targeting and messaging to very specific types of buyers. For example, if you have a service area that has a higher vacancy rate, you could consider creating ads that highlight the great opportunities in the area and any properties available. Or, alternatively, hone in on hot rental markets and share helpful information like how to know where to buy a rental property. If you have access to analytics, finding out where people are searching from is also a great way to create a strategy and serve ads to people who are most likely to be interested in your area, whether local investors or out-of-state buyers. And, you can also advertise specific properties that investors are most interested in such as apartment buildings, condos, single-family homes, and multifamily properties, depending on your area and ideal customers’ needs. 

Demonstrate local knowledge

Demonstrating that you have expert knowledge in your service area on the community, neighborhood, and even street level is key to attracting real estate investors, just as it is for all buyers. Investors often look for more guidance from real estate agents, even if they’ve been investing for awhile. They want to know you’ll have answers to their questions and advise them on the best way to achieve their goals. By showcasing your knowledge of the area, such as reasons people live there, school information, commute times, popular restaurants, shops, and things to do, local laws and regulations like zoning, building regulations, and tax information, and more, you can provide investors with the information they need to make an informed decision. And, you’ll position yourself as a go-to resource and build trust and credibility.  

You can showcase your area knowledge by leveraging social media for real estate. Highlight businesses by interviewing owners or write a spotlight on your blog about local events so you can share it on your social platforms. Or, create video tours of listings you have and share them on social media by uploading them to the platform or linking to your YouTube channel and website. On Instagram, you can incorporate hashtags such as #investmentproperty or #justlisted that can help get your listings in front of more investors. 

Optimize your website for real estate investors

Having a search-engine optimized, user-friendly real estate website is essential for increasing awareness and generating leads of all kinds. Specifically, though, for targeting real estate investors, building a landing page or pages that are focused on how you can help them and what resources you provide is key. And, it’s just the start. Be sure to include relevant keywords such as “investment property in [your area]” or “investment opportunity in [your area]”, as well as answer questions investors may have. Google loves short answer questions as people have increasingly searched long phrases and questions, using voice assistants like Alexa, Siri, and Google. In addition to keyword optimization, ensure pages have relevant, optimized metadata, and technical SEO in place, such as the right URL structure and optimized images. Further, build out valuable content by creating and prominently featuring pre-populated listings pages with properties that investors might be interested in (like properties looking for cash offers) and adding helpful links to area information, investor frequently asked questions (FAQs), property management resources and more. Having strong real estate investor tailored SEO and content is a great way to ensure you stand out to investors and make it easier for them to confidently explore their options with you. 

Elevate listing descriptions

Another area of your marketing that can be optimized for real estate investors is your listing descriptions. Because investors are searching for as much information as possible about a property and the area in order to make an informed decision, listing descriptions are a great place to start when considering what to highlight and why. Use the listing description to tell the story of the property on the listing page and the other places it appears (for example, in a MLS search performed on a website that’s not your own). Describe what features it has so potential buyers can find the basic information and also detail what’s in the surrounding area and why people love living there, as well as income opportunities, so investors understand the property and how much value they can get from it in the future. 

Share local market reports and statistics

One of the most effective ways of showcasing your area knowledge is through area statistics and local market reports. Create market reports or provide updates based on what you’re seeing in your local market and have them accessible for others to download from your website. Make sure to add your own spin to statistics, as it’s the story the data tells (i.e. this is an up and coming area) more so than the actual numbers that will resonate with others and get them to follow, and trust, you. You can also write a blog post highlighting real estate trends and market information including statistics like average sales price, time on the market, etc. and email them out or share them on social media. People regularly search for and follow people who talk about and share real estate trends, so this is an opportunity for you to both get in front of potential clients and become known as a resource for real estate and investment properties in your area.

Stay top of mind for repeat business and referrals

Staying top of mind is key across the board in the real estate industry and for any marketing strategy to be effective. And, for those interested in marketing to real estate investors, staying top of mind is essential. Investors are typically looking to buy and sell properties much faster than typical buyers and sellers. By staying top of mind to real estate investors, you can earn repeat business and referrals to other potential investors. To do this, create a content marketing strategy that demonstrates your value even after closing, such as sharing guides, how-to’s, and relevant information about the community and even more so, different investment strategies (i.e. you’ve bought your first investment property, now what?). Stay top of mind with your sphere by sharing investor-targeted content in an email newsletter, blog, and on social media (start with the blog and link back to it for maximum SEO value). 

Market ancillary services

Often real estate investors have their hands full with multiple properties. By marketing your ancillary services, you can position your business as a one-stop-shop for real estate investors. You’ll strengthen your value with your potential customers and potentially earn more revenue from the same transaction. Plus, marketing your ancillary businesses keeps your company top of mind for anything real estate-related and can result in both repeat business from people with whom you’ve worked in the past and new business from non-real estate sales sources (i.e. an investor who works with a different agent, but wants to explore new financing options might decide to work with you for real estate sales and mortgage financing after starting out talking to you about financing only). If you don’t offer ancillary services, create a landing page on your website with your local connections and recommended companies for related services. You’ll drive traffic to your website, get other businesses and connections talking about you as well, and position yourself as a resource investors can go to with any question and need.
